Overview of the Municipality

Saint-Modeste is a rural village located just south of Rivière-du-Loup in the Bas-Saint-Laurent region. The community is known for its agricultural fields, forest corridors, family-oriented neighbourhoods and quiet small-town atmosphere. Municipal services are provided by the Municipalité de Saint-Modeste.

With approximately 1,300 residents, Saint-Modeste offers calm rural living with the convenience of being only minutes from the commercial, educational and healthcare services of Rivière-du-Loup. Healthcare access is supported regionally by the CISSS du Bas-Saint-Laurent.

Popular Neighbourhoods

Rue Principale / Village Core

The central village district, where essential services, the church and community facilities are located. Housing includes single-family homes on generous lots, duplexes and updated heritage properties. Ideal for residents who value proximity to local events, school access and walkable streets.

Chemin du Lac / Woodland & Recreation Edge

A quiet corridor lined with homes near wooded areas, trails and small lakes. Popular for those who enjoy nature at their doorstep—especially outdoor enthusiasts, retirees and teleworkers seeking scenic calm.

Rang Petit-Modeste / Agricultural Valley Belt

A countryside stretch with farmhouses, large-lot residences and open agricultural terrain. Suitable for buyers seeking space for gardens, orchards, animals or homestead living.

Rang de l’Église / Hillside & Countryside Views

An elevated rural area with scenic outlooks over farmlands and wooded ridges. Attractive for custom builds, privacy-focused homes and properties designed around nature and landscape appreciation.
